What Is All-In or Fold Bingo?
All-In or Fold Bingo is a side game played identically to standard bingo. However, instead of numbers, your bingo card is made up of playing cards

Are any All-In or Fold games excluded from Bingo?
Yes. VIP tables (limits of $50/$100 and higher), All-In Or Fold Sit & Go games and any All-In or Fold games with All-In Fortune will not feature All-In or Fold Bingo, nor will they make any contributions to the bingo fund.

How do I get a spot covered on my All-In or Fold bingo card?
To cover a spot you need to win or chop a hand at showdown whilst holding that card in your hole cards.

I won a hand where everyone else folded, do I get a spot on my bingo card if one of my hole cards is on the bingo board?
No. To cover a spot on your bingo card you must win or chop a hand with that card at showdown.

How will I know if the cards I hold are on my All-In or Fold Bingo card?
The cards in your hand that are on your All-In Or Fold Bingo card will be highlighted and a sound will play to alert you.

How do I win at All-In or Fold Bingo?
The game plays the same as standard bingo. Complete one line on your bingo card horizontally, vertically or diagonally.
The 'Four Corners' which is regarded as a win in some bingo games is not regarded as a win here.

What are the prizes for All-In or Fold Bingo?
Rewards go up to $16,000 in Hold’em.

I've got a line! How is my prize decided?
You will spin a wheel and be awarded a prize ranging from 8BB to 800BB.

Is there a limited time to make a line at All-In or Fold Bingo?
Yes. If you are playing Hold'em you have 50 hands to complete a line.

Can I increase the number of hands I have left to complete my winning line?
No. However, a feature of the game is that you can be awarded a random number of 'bonus hands' from time to time and this is a random award.

What are 'bonus hands' in All-In or Fold Bingo?
Random drops of bonus hands can be awarded by the game giving players more time to create a line on their Bingo card. This can be awarded up to once every 25 hands.

Do I have to use all the hands left before I can get a new bingo card?

No. Once 10 hands have been used on your timer you have the option to reset the game with a new card and new hands left.

I ran out of hands to complete my bingo card, what happens now?
A new game will start automatically, with a new hand countdown.

How is All-In or Fold Bingo Funded?
A 'Bingo Fee' Is taken from each hand where you are dealt cards. This ranges from 0.025BB to 0.07BB depending on the buy-in.

Can I Opt-Out of Bingo and not pay the fee?
No. By playing on a table where All-In or Fold Bingo is offered, you agree to participate in the game.

If I need to sit out, will my bingo card be saved?
Yes. As long as the table remains open, your bingo card progress will be saved for up to 1 hour. Should the table be closed, your bingo game will reset.

My bingo game was interrupted by server maintenance. What happens here?
If the bingo board resets due to server maintenance, the bingo fee will be returned per bingo cards marked.
